Is it possible to do 3x3 or 4x4 planes each side on a 6'x 4' table using 1/200 scale planes?

Can a 6' x 4' table handle a squadron vs squadron engagement using 1/285 planes?

Dynaman878910 Aug 2019 5:28 p.m. PST

Depending on the rules that is enough for 20+ planes on a side. Black Cross Blue Sky (something like that) can handle it.

a 6x4 table can handle 20 1/200 scale planes?….I didn't think that would give enough room for maneuvering?

Thresher0110 Aug 2019 5:41 p.m. PST

1/300th, or smaller scales, like 1/600th would be better, in my opinion.

Smaller battles will be best.

Squadron sized engagements would be best with 1/600th scale minis on this size of table. Using larger minis with that many aircraft (squadrons) will be pushing it, and maneuvering room will be very tight, in my opinion.

I wouldn't use aircraft larger than 1/300th for squadron sized battles on a 6' x 4' table.

If you can get a folding, ping-pong table, that'll almost double your playing area.

Blood red Skies uses 1:200 planes, and a 6 vs 6 engagement fits easily on a 4 foot square table.

khanscom11 Aug 2019 4:26 p.m. PST

Played a "Sturmovik Commander" campaign a few years ago on a table that size-- some games with up to 8 a/c per side (all in 1/285- 1/300). No problem.
